| Based on my own economic situation as an artist,
I build myself a
microcosm that pays its own way to a certain extent, so that I am
not forced to depend entirely on exhibition budgets. It is absurd
that there are virtually no exhibitions for which you receive a
fee for having your name on the wall, although you do the intellectual
work up front. In my projects, I examine these economic structures
and, like a producer, I set up a framework in which everyone involved
acts as a co-producer.
— Swetlana Heger
